CO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 Mt. Zion Missionary Baptist Church in downtown Jackson marked its 115th anniversary today at 201 West Chester Street, inviting the community for fellowship. Church leaders including Pastors Ricky Reed, Steve Trailer, Marcus Perkins, and Rev. Lee Wilkins spoke during the celebration—one of the few churches to remain a downtown anchor for so long. CULTURE NEWS
- ➤ The West TN Quartet Reunion Association presented A Night of Worship at 4 p.m. at Macedonia Missionary Baptist Church (106 Glass Street) in Jackson. The free benefit concert featured male and female vocalists singing songs of praise while donations were accepted for charities, with proceeds going to St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ital, the Salvation Army’s Angel Tree program, and Christ Community Health Center.
